Details of E 361/9
Reference: E 361/9
Description:

Great wardrobe, wardrobe of the king's household and the king's chamber: 27 rots:

  • Great wardrobe: Thomas de Useflete, clerk, 20 Edw II, rot 1;
  • Great wardrobe: Thomas de Useflete, clerk, 2-3 Edw III, rot 2;
  • Great wardrobe: William la Zouche, clerk, 3 Edw III, rot 3-5;
  • Great wardrobe: William la Zouche, clerk Also includes account for certain receipts in the receipt of the Exchequer in 6 Edw III, 4 Edw III, 6 Edw III, rot 6-8;
  • Great wardrobe: William la Zouche, clerk, 5-6 Edw III, rot 9-10;
  • Great wardrobe: William la Zouche, clerk, 6-7 Edw III, rot 11-13;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Roger de Waltham, 15-[17] Edw II, rot 14-15;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Robert de Woodhouse, 17-[18] Edw II, rot 16;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Robert de Woodhouse, [18] Edw II, rot 17;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Robert de Woodhouse, 19 Edw II, rot 18;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Robert de Woodhouse, 20 Edw II, rot 18;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Robert de Woodhouse, 20 Edw II-2 Edw III, rot 19-20;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Thomas de Garton, 3-5 Edw III, rot 21-22;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: John de Bensted, 1-2 Edw II, rot 23-24;
  • Wardrobe of the king's household: Richard de Bury, 2-3 Edw III, rot 25;
  • William de Langley, clerk of the receipt, and his expenses from the time he was deputed by the king to receive various sums in the chamber, 16-20 Edw II, rot 26-27

Date: 1307 July 8-1333 Jan 24
